KU64 HRM is a 2015 Seat Alhambra in Black with a 1,968c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 100%.
Across all 2015 Seat Alhambra models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.5% with a typical mileage of 72,210 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Seat Alhambra f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 23,231 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KU64 HRM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Seat Alhambra typ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 11 years old, this Seat Alhambra is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
